Do-it-Yourself Metal Polishing Tips
Practical Metal Finishing - Most of the time, metal polishing is necessary for appearance and for clean-room usage. It's one of the most common techniques for its utility in intensifying the natural attractiveness of the product, such as, kitchenware, motor vehicle parts or motor bike parts. Additionally, a large number of clean-rooms call for a polished finish as a way to decrease the permeability of the components that will result in debris to gather and contaminate. A superb instance of this application would be in a vacuum chamber. There are actually a good number of methods of finish metal, and let us look into a number of the methods required. Metals may be burnished by hand, with specialized buffing machines, electromechanically or chemically. A buffing paste or compound can be applied, that can consist of dolomite, aluminum oxide, tripoli, chromium oxide, limestone, chalk, or iron oxide. Polishing stainless steel, because of its substandard thermal conductivity, rather high viscidity, and hardness is among the most time intensive. Conversely, things manufactured from non-ferrous metals are much more receptive to buffing, because they demand the lowest number of operations.
Any time a superior processing quality just isn't mandatory, faster pad speeds should be employed. A slower pad speed is applied if a high standard mirror finish is important. Finishing buffs smothered with compound are somewhat affected by the pressures on the surface of the pad. The concentration of the pressure on the surface can be amplified within certain restrictions, but placing above the ideal degree of load not simply cuts down the quality level of treatment, but in addition lessens the level of efficiency, can bring about wear to the component, and there's furthermore an evident heating of the work-pieces, an outcome of friction. When working thinner metal, it is higher heat (and a corresponding bendability of the material) which can cause materials to warp, buckle or distort. Overall, it requires a qualified polisher to factor in all of these elements to both not cause harm to the piece and to operate effectively. To help appreciably increase the quality of the completed surface, the polishing operation ought to be carried out with a lot less power and not so much force in an effort to after a while complete a surface with no scratches or marks resulting from the polishing process, thus arriving at a lovely mirror finish.
